I was still in-hospital at 4 days post-op (I had problems with inflammation in the lining of my sleeve). The first time I went to the Y, after getting home, was on day 9 post-op. I walked 30 minutes at 2.5mph. Yesterday I walked 40 minutes at 2.8mph. This morning, day 16, I walked 60 minutes at 2.7mph. The length and speed that I walk depends greatly on my energy level, on any given day. Some days I feel fantastic, and push a little harder. Some days (like this morning) I feel really drained, and trade time walked for speed. Listen to your body, whatever you do, and don't push yourself to the point of being wobbly! Best of luck to you!

I agree with Kathy in that 60 minutes at a stretch is a bit much. My doctor recommends 10 minutes at a time to total up to about 30 minutes a day. He also says to push if you want to, but listen to your body. We're in Texas, so it's sweltering hot. He says to work out in the early mornings/ Late evenings or go do the infamous MALL WALK.
